Abstract

The invention discloses a two-way driving switch valve group control to realize two steering mode hydraulic systems, including a hydraulic oil tank, a hydraulic pump, an overflow valve, a filter, a solenoid valve, a switch valve group, a front steering gear, a rear steering gear, and a front steering oil cylinder , Rear steering oil cylinder, the inlet of the hydraulic pump is connected to the hydraulic oil tank, the outlet is connected to the overflow valve and the filter in turn, the outlet of the filter is connected to the inlet of the solenoid valve, the two outlets of the solenoid valve are respectively connected to the front steering gear and the rear steering gear, and the solenoid valve The oil return port of the valve is connected to the hydraulic oil tank, the two outlets of the front steering gear are respectively connected with the switch valve group and the front steering cylinder, the two outlets of the rear steering gear are respectively connected with the switch valve group and the rear steering cylinder, and the front steering cylinder and the rear steering cylinder are connected respectively. The oil cylinders are respectively connected with the switching valve group, and the oil return ports of the front steering gear and the rear steering gear are respectively connected with the hydraulic oil tank. The switching of the vehicle steering mode is realized through the switch valve group, the front and rear steering gear and the hydraulic system, which reduces the steering radius of the vehicle and improves the steering flexibility of the vehicle.

Description

technical field [0001] The invention relates to the field of vehicle steering, in particular to a hydraulic system for realizing two steering modes through control of a two-way driving switch valve group. Background technique [0002] At present, two-way driving vehicles can generally realize front-wheel steering or rear-wheel steering, or use a figure-of-eight steering mode in which the front and rear wheels turn simultaneously. If the front-wheel steering or rear-wheel steering is used alone, the turning radius of the vehicle is large, and the steering is not flexible enough in a small space; if the figure-of-eight steering mode is used alone, it is easy to generate an S-shaped path under the working conditions that require straight walking.
